This is a key post with leading lung cancer charity, Roy Castle Lung Cancer Foundation, to develop and drive community engagement activities on a national level. The role will involve coordinating and delivering community-based events where you will be directly engaging with the general public to improve understanding around lung cancer and the importance of screening.
This is a hybrid role with time spent in the charity’s head office and remote working, plus national travel on a regular basis.
Title: Community Engagement Assistant
Responsible To: Community Engagement Manager
Salary: £24,000 - £28,000
Hours: 34 hours per week (typically Mon-Fri. Some weekend work also required)
Location: Head Office (Liverpool) / Remote Working, with regular travel across the UK
Overall Objective
* To work with the Community Engagement Manager to coordinate and deliver community engagement activities and support charitable objectives.
* To support the Director of Communications and Engagement and Community Engagement Manager in delivering the strategy for the expansion of community engagement activities throughout the UK.
Key Responsibilities
* Coordinate and manage the preparation of community-based events, including sourcing suitable locations, supplying necessary documentation and ordering materials.
* Support in the delivery of community-based events by proactively engaging with the general public.
* Collect and collate data for event evaluations and future funding bids.
* Prepare evaluation reports for the Community Engagement Manager.
* Identify potential partnership and funding opportunities, including local NHS teams and corporate businesses.
* Manage the in-house booking process for community engagement materials.
* Be a visible and proactive representative for the charity.
